HA8 9RE is a small residential postcode area in England, home to around 1,960 people. It occupies a compact cluster of properties, offering a quiet, community-focused environment. The area is served by multiple transport links, including Edgware and Burnt Oak train stations, which connect residents to nearby towns and the wider London network. Daily life here is shaped by its proximity to retail hubs like Co-op Edgware, Tesco Edgware, and Sainsburys Edgware, ensuring convenience for shopping and errands. The area’s demographics suggest a mature population, with a median age of 47 and a strong presence of adults aged 30–64. This creates a stable, established community where many residents are homeowners, contributing to a sense of continuity. While the area lacks natural constraints like protected woodlands or wetlands, its low flood risk and below-average crime rates make it an attractive option for those prioritising safety and practicality. Living in HA8 9RE means balancing accessibility to urban amenities with the tranquillity of a smaller, tightly knit neighbourhood.

HA8 9RE is primarily an owner-occupied area, with 73% of residents living in homes they own. The accommodation type is predominantly houses, which are more common than flats or other forms of housing. This suggests a market skewed towards family homes and long-term residency, rather than a rental-focused area. The high home ownership rate indicates strong local investment and a desire for stability, which can be appealing to buyers seeking a place to settle. However, the small size of the area means the housing stock is limited, and opportunities for new builds or developments may be constrained. For buyers, this implies a competitive market with fewer properties available, but also a lower risk of rapid price fluctuations. The presence of established homes also means that properties in HA8 9RE are likely to retain value, particularly given the area’s low crime risk and good transport links.
